Have you ever chuckled at a funny warning sign? While they might bring a smile, can they also protect businesses from liability? In the intriguing case of Smith v. The Purple Frog, Inc., a bar faced a negligence claim after a patron was injured by a heater, despite a humorous warning sign. The court’s decision highlights the balance between humor and legal responsibility, exploring whether clear warnings can truly shield establishments from claims.
